As artificial intelligence and digital transformation continue to reshape the global economy, the conversation around women in technology is no longer just about gender equality — it is increasingly about innovation, competitiveness, and sustainable growth.

In a recent interview with Vietnam Economic Times, the leadership of Women in Tech® Vietnam - Ms. Quyen Nguyen shared insights on the opportunities and challenges for women pursuing careers in the technology sector in Vietnam.

Today, women account for approximately 35% of the technology workforce in Vietnam, which is higher than the global average of around 30–32%. However, women remain underrepresented in leadership positions, particularly in senior technology and executive roles.

As AI and emerging technologies shape the future of work, diversity in technology development becomes increasingly important. Greater participation of women in tech helps reduce bias in technology design, encourages inclusive innovation, and contributes to building more balanced digital systems for society.

With this vision, Women in Tech® Vietnam continues to work toward building a stronger ecosystem that supports women in technology through initiatives focused on:

• Education and digital skills development
• Supporting women tech entrepreneurs
• Promoting inclusive leadership and workplace diversity
• Strengthening community networks and policy dialogue

Empowering women in technology is not only about creating equal opportunities — it is about unlocking Vietnam’s full innovation potential in the digital era.
